WebAug 28, 2014 · The High Court ruling in Symes v St George’s Healthcare NHS Trust [2014] EWHC 2505 was part of a clinical negligence case in which the claimant’s case is that a misdiagnosis of a lump in his face and a delay in carrying out a superficial parotidectomy caused him to require a total parotidectomy involving loss of the facial nerve and … WebNov 11, 2014 · Default Judgement: Symes v St George’s Healthcare NHS Trust 5. An NHS trust was entitled to challenge causation where a default judgment had been entered on …
